Answer:
A plane extends infinitely in two dimensions. It has no thickness. An example of a plane is a coordinate plane. A plane is named by three points in the plane that are not on the same line.

Answer:
Step-by-step explanation:
Equation of a line giving 2 points is
y-y1=m(x-x1) where m is the slope and (x1,y1) is one of the points.
First we have to find the slope using formula
(y2-y1)/(x2-x1) where (x1,y1) and (x2,y2) are the points given
Slope m is (4-13)/(8--4) =-9/12 = -3/4
Looking at the answer choices, the only slope intercept equation that use the slope -3/4 is answer choice A
